two day workshop on advanced technologies-plastic waste use in road construction concludes

An excellent 2 day training curriculum on Customized Capacity Building on advanced technologies, utilization of spend plastic in road construction, and road security precautions in Ladakh concluded on July 12 at Syed Mehdi Auditorium Hall Kargil.

The training was organised by Rural Development and Panchayat Raj Department( RD&PRD) UT Ladakh.

Professional Engineer REW Er Shabbir Hussain extended gratitude to the instructors and UT Administration for the successful conduct of the LACE level workshop and expected more such events later on as well.

He expressed satisfaction over the workshop and said that the engineers from Kargil would have taken maximum advantages of this program, the way it was curated and executed.

The two day workshop witnessed various lectures and presentations on the use of plastic in street construction in the cold region by Dr. Ambika Behl Primary Scientist/ HOD Central Road Research Company( CRRI), Principal Scientist Dr. Abhishek Mittal, Principal Scientist Gaagandep Singh, Scientist Rajiv Kumar, and Elderly Scientist Dr. G Bharath.

The training covered subjects like usage of plastic waste, utilization of locally available material, cold blend technology for faster road building, testing technologies, design and building of flexible pavements, road security, recycling of bituminous pavements, and maintenance rehabilitation technologies, etc.

Pertinently, CRRI, New Delhi is a specialized laboratory of the Authorities of Scientific& Industrial Study( CSIR) engaged in carrying away research and development projects on the design, construction, and repair of roads and runways, traffic and transportation planning of towns, management of roads, utilization of commercial waste in road building, ground improvements environmental pollution, street traffic safety, and allied activities.
